> Your ada3 disk is different from the other two.  Can you please provide
> the output from the following 3 commands?
> 
> camcontrol identify ada2
> camcontrol identify ada3
> camcontrol identify ada4
> 
> > vfs.zfs.cache_flush_disable=1
> > vfs.zfs.zil_disable=1
> 
> I question both of these settings, especially the latter.  Please remove
> them both and re-test your write performance.

I removed all settings of zfs.
Now it default.
